Timezone in Sant’Anna Avagnina

Sant’Anna Avagnina is located in the Europe/Rome timezone, which has a standard UTC offset of +1 hour. During daylight saving time, which typically runs from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the offset shifts to UTC +2 hours. This means that in summer, the local time is advanced by one hour to make better use of daylight.
